Heard the very sad news yesterday of the death of the legend, and mainstay of The Jazz Butcher, Pat Fish. I’m not sure how well known the fella was to anyone on here, but he was one of those acts that I’ve loved since my mid teens. I last saw him in Preston about 5 years back, supporting fellow ex-Creation act, The Jasmine Minks. He was, of course, absolutely hammered by the end of the night, in true Fish style. He was a lovely fella responsible for some cracking tunes and will be sadly missed.
